摘要
The sheer viscosity has been studied in a nitrobenzene-decane critical mixture above the critical consolute temperature T-c, in the homogeneous phase, and below T-c, in coexisting phases. The form of background viscosity for coexisting phases has been postulated. The same value of the critical exponent phi has been obtained in the lower (L), upper (U), and homogeneous (H) phases. The pretransitional amplitudes (A(L,U)) in coexisting phases are approximately the same, whereas A(L,U) /A(H) approximate to 0.965. In the homogeneous phase the possibility of the appearance of the quasinematic, field-induced structure of critical fluctuations has been discussed.
